What are Built In Tv Cabinet Plans?

Built in TV cabinet plans are detailed instructions for building a custom cabinet that is designed to fit a TV and other media equipment. These plans provide measurements, materials needed, and step-by-step instructions for constructing the cabinet.

Why Choose a Built In TV Cabinet?

One of the main advantages of a built-in TV cabinet is that it can be customized to fit the specific needs of your space. This allows you to maximize storage and create a seamless look that blends in with your decor. Additionally, built-in cabinets can add value to your home and make it more attractive to potential buyers.

Pros and Cons of Built In Tv Cabinet Plans

Like any home improvement project, there are pros and cons to building a built-in TV cabinet:

Pros:

  • Customizable to fit your specific needs and space
  • Maximizes storage space and reduces clutter
  • Adds value to your home
  • Can be designed to integrate with smart technology
  • Creates a seamless look that blends in with your decor

Cons:

  • Can be expensive, depending on the materials and design
  • Requires advanced DIY skills or professional installation
  • May limit flexibility if you want to move your TV or change the layout of your room

Question & Answer and FAQs

Q: How much does it cost to build a built-in TV cabinet?

A: The cost of building a built-in TV cabinet will depend on the materials you choose and the design you want. On average, you can expect to spend between $500 and $2,000.

Q: How long does it take to build a built-in TV cabinet?

A: The time it takes to build a built-in TV cabinet will depend on the complexity of the design and your DIY skills. On average, you can expect to spend between 2-4 weeks on the project.

Q: Can I build a built-in TV cabinet myself?

A: If you have advanced DIY skills, you can build a built-in TV cabinet yourself. However, if you’re not experienced with DIY projects, it’s best to hire a professional to help with the installation.
